We may not be as ‘extreme’, but we are really excited about our sixth MultiFaith Council Habitat for Humanity Build with partners CitiFinancial and Lowe’s. 

Faith group participants include the Baha’i Faith; Church of the Brethren (Heatherdowns); Church of God, Seventh Day; Corpus Christi University Parish; First Church of Christ, Scientist – Maumee; First Unitarian Church; Hindu Temple of Toledo; Islamic Center of Greater Toledo; Masjid Saad; Muslim American Society – Toledo; Religious Science; Sufi Faith; Toledo Buddhist Sangha; Trinity Episcopal Church; United Jewish Council of Greater Toledo, Inc.; and Unity of Toledo. 

Additional support comes from Anthem Blue Cross and Blue Shield – Toledo; Dad Patchen, Inc – Electric; Boy Scout Troop 154; Mick Electric; Panera’s; Stylecraft, Fremont; and West Toledo Rotary.  Maumee Valley Habitat for Humanity has additional sponsors.

Our partner family is looking forward to the building of their new home.  The Build starts Saturday, September 27 and continues through October 25, with dedication slated for Tuesday, November 11, at 6:00 PM.

We are pleased to announce the 2008 MultiFaith Habitat Build, our Sixth Build.  The Build starts on Saturday, September 27.
We are building a four-bedroom, 2-bath home for Sabrina English, her children Jamie (18), Channing (13), Caullin (11), and grandson Jordyn (1).  It will be at 429 Waybridge Rd, Toledo, OH 43612.
The steering committee meetings for faith group representatives will be at 7 PM Sept. 9 and 16 at our home 3009 Gunckel Blvd, Toledo, 43606 – near Toledo Hospital.
Faith groups and other sponsors may send their financial contributions, checks to Maumee Valley Habitat for Humanity, to the Gunckel address for data basing and forwarding to our Build.  Individual contributions may be made in honor of a special person.
The Volunteer Rally Potluck and Build Blessing will be held Wednesday, September 24, from 6:30 – 8:30 at the Hindu Temple of Toledo, 4336 King Road, Sylvania, OH  43560.
